
That's this year in case you're lost. Actually, Sony's (growingly infamous) handheld will likely only make its Japanese debut by year's end. According to Chief Technical Officer Masayuki Chatani, "[PSP will] definitely be able to launch at the end of the year." Sony has made these types of claims before with the PlayStation, but Chatani assured the doubters that the PSP's development is "far better". As for a US/European release, there's no definite date, but if the PSP does appear in Japan by December, we can expect to see a westward expansion sometime in the spring of 2005.
